COBs, Engines, Modules, Strips

LED lighting in large scale often requires a COB (chip on board), Engine, Module, or Strip. COB lighting combines numerous LED die onto one substrate, taking up much less space than a traditional array of SMD LEDs. LED engines combine SMD LED's with resistors to create a ready to use light. LED modules use tiny LED's similar to a COB but they are still easily individually visible unlike with COB's. These are available in different color options, CCT values, lumens, current, and voltage options. They also come in an array of configurations such as strips, flexible strips, rectangles, discs, and starboards.
